Princess Lilibet, a three-year-old daughter of Meghan Markle and Prince Harry, Duke of Sussex, received her first public appearance in a touching picture shared on Meghan’s newly opened lifestyle brand website.

Mother-Daughter Moment

The mother-daughter duo is being seen holding hands on a lovely green field, with palm trees and Pacific Ocean serenity as a backdrop. The picture featuring Lilibet’s striking red hair was released as part of Meghan’s rebranded lifestyle platform, As Ever, People magazine reports.

The brand will now operate as As Ever and used to be known as the American Riviera Orchard since February 18. Aspects of food, gardening, and intentional living reflect Meghan’s long-time passion for her lifestyle brand. The name change came just two weeks before the forthcoming March 4 premiere of her Netflix series With Love.

Meghan Markle’s Post

In an Instagram video, Meghan, 43, shared why she stepped off the “American Riviera Orchard” name. She noted that the name sounded truly appealing initially, but it was geographically constricting. One of Megan’s fans shared an Instagram post, writing, “Positive vibes from @meghan As ever ?.”

“Last year, I thought, ‘American Riviera sounds like such a great name.’ It’s my neighborhood; it’s a nickname for Santa Barbara. But it limited me to things that were just manufactured and grown in this area,” she explained.

Meghan also acknowledged that Netflix helped shape her path, saying, “Then Netflix came on, not just as my partner in the show but also in my business, which was huge.” She also disclosed that in 2022, she had secured the name As Ever while biding her time to present it properly. “It essentially means ‘as it’s meant to be.”
